Post-Surgery Treatment Instructions



After going through LASIK surgery, it's essential to purely comply with the post-surgery care instructions provided by your eye specialist. Your eye specialist will likely recommend utilizing recommended eye drops to avoid infection and promote healing. Keep in mind to use these decreases as instructed to guarantee correct healing.

Avoid massaging or touching your eyes, as this can bring about complications and impede the healing process. It's necessary to use the protective eye guard provided to you, specifically while sleeping, to prevent mistakenly rubbing your eyes during the night.

Additionally, avoid participating in difficult activities or swimming for at least a week post-surgery to avoid any kind of potential damage to your eyes. Go to all follow-up appointments scheduled with your eye surgeon to monitor your progression and deal with any kind of problems promptly.

Handling Pain and Negative Effects



To handle discomfort and side effects following your LASIK surgical procedure, it's important to recognize usual signs and symptoms that may emerge. It's regular to experience some dry skin, itching, or moderate discomfort in the first couple of days post-surgery. Your eyes might also be sensitive to light or seem like there's something in them. To minimize these signs and symptoms, your optometrist may suggest using lubricating eye decreases and putting on protective sunglasses when outdoors.




Some individuals might likewise notice momentary changes in vision, such as glare, halos, or difficulty with night vision. These issues generally improve as your eyes heal. If you experience extreme discomfort, abrupt vision adjustments, or persistent discomfort, contact your physician quickly.

Stay clear of rubbing your eyes, swimming, or making use of jacuzzis during the preliminary healing duration to prevent complications.
